Crown Royal Northern Harvest Rye

Canadian — Manitoba, Canada

Reviewed December 4, 2017
3.0
3.0 out of 5 stars
It's definitely pretty good but for me personally leaves a bit to be desired. Compared to Redemption Rye (similar mashbill) it's a decent but smoother. The Redemption will punch you in the face with it's spiced/Rye nose. I suspect this mashbill has corn in it where the redemption does not. While this Rye is by no means bad I personally find it a bit lacking in terms of what I like in my flavor profiles. It takes a bit of the Rye punch off which can be good or bad depending on what you're in the mood for, but beyond the subtle/interesting nose (for a high rye mash) this ain't got much going for it. It's simply too smooth/subtle after the nose to really get much of anything. Obviously these reviews are subjective. If you can find this whiskey decently priced (<$35) then see for yourself if you like it. I definitely think it's pretty good but I can get stuff I prefer for the price. Namely Knob Creek Rye if you want the best of both worlds (of a rye with high corn in the mash) or Redemption Rye if you want the true, high/pure Rye experience.
